La Mirada Theatre Welcomes TRAVELLING LIGHT 2/19

La-Mirada-Theatre-Welcomes-TRAVELING-LIGHT-20010101

La Mirada Theatre for the Performing Arts will present the fourth High Definition screening of this season’s National Theatre Live series, TRAVELLING LIGHT, written by Nicholas Wright and directed by National Theatre’s Nicholas Hytner on SUNDAY, FEBRUARY 19 at 2pm at La Mirada Theatre for the Performing Arts, 14900 La Mirada Blvd. in La Mirada.

About the show: "In a remote village in Eastern Europe, around 1900, the young Motl Mendl is entranced by the flickering silent images on his father’s cinematograph. Bankrolled by Jacob, the ebullient local timber merchant, and inspired by Anna, the girl sent to help him make Moving Pictures of their village, he stumbles on a revolutionary way of story-telling. Forty years on, Motl – now a famed American film director – looks back on his early life and confronts the cost of fulfilling his dreams. "I know it was in the picture. I made the picture and now the cow’s getting paid and I’m not!" Following Vincent in Brixton and The Reporter, Nicholas Wright’s new play is a funny and?fascinating tribute to the Eastern European immigrants who became major players in?Hollywood’s golden age. The award-winning Antony Sher – whose previous work with the?National Theatre includes Primo and Stanley – returns to play Jacob."

The cast of TRAVELLING LIGHT includes Mark Extance,? Colin Haigh, ?Paul Jesson, Sue Kelvin,? Abigail McKern, ?Damien Molony, Lauren O’Neil. ?Antony Sher,? Karl Theobald?and Alexis Zegerman.
National Theatre LIVE performances are filmed live in high definition and broadcast via satellite to over 700 cinemas around the world, live in Europe and time delayed in the US and Canada, and delayed screenings in countries further afield. There are over 120 venues in the UK alongside venues in the USA, Canada, Australia, New Zealand, South Africa, Mexico, India, Scandinavia and Europe. The performances at the National are nominated in advance to allow cameras greater freedom in the auditorium.

National Theatre LIVE is presented in partnership with Aviva.

LEONARDO LIVE offers an unprecedented opportunity for audiences worldwide to experience these da Vinci works. The historic exhibition is sold out in London and, due to the fragility of the paintings, the exhibition cannot tour. Captured live on the eve of the exhibition opening in London this fall, LEONARDO LIVE will provide a high-definition walk-through of the landmark exhibition, in-depth commentary about featured pieces in the exhibit and extra content.

LA MIRADA THEATRE FOR THE PERFORMING ARTS is located at 14900 La Mirada Boulevard in La Mirada, near the intersection of Rosecrans Avenue where the 91 and 5 freeways meet. Parking is free.
